1. Embrace 'Tile Drenching' for a Luxe Bathroom Makeover
The "tile drenching" trend involves enveloping bathroom surfaces—walls, floors, and even ceilings—with the same tile, creating a cohesive and immersive environment. Designers recommend using large or medium-sized tiles in solid colors or materials with subtle variations, such as marble or travertine, to achieve a calming and visually unified effect. This approach offers a luxurious, serene tone to interiors and can elevate the bathroom's appeal. (thespruce.com)
2. Adopt the 'Unfitted Kitchen' Concept for Flexibility and Character
Moving away from traditional built-in cabinetry, the unfitted kitchen trend embraces freestanding furniture to create a personalized and adaptable cooking space. This design allows for greater freedom in layout and the ability to move and repurpose pieces as needed. Incorporating mixed materials like wood and metal, along with open shelving, adds a layered effect and fosters a narrative of individuality and timeless design. (bhg.com)
3. Incorporate Gingham and Plaid Tiles for a Nostalgic Yet Modern Touch
Gingham and plaid tiling are gaining popularity for their nostalgic yet contemporary aesthetic. Inspired by classic textiles, these patterns bring charm and warmth to kitchens and bathrooms. Experts suggest using matte-finish tiles, terracotta, porcelain, and handcrafted Zellige or cement tiles to underscore the artisanal appeal. Pairing these tiles with natural, minimalistic elements allows the pattern to stand out, adding a unique character to your space. (bhg.com)
4. Explore the 'Concealed Kitchen' Trend for a Sleek, Minimalist Aesthetic
The concealed kitchen design incorporates built-in appliances, flush cabinetry, and appliance garages to keep everything neatly hidden. This approach results in a sleek, minimalist aesthetic that enhances the feeling of space and organization. Ideal for open concept living areas, it creates a seamless flow between your kitchen and living spaces, making your home feel more expansive and cohesive. (houzz.com)
5. Utilize Natural Materials for a Spa-Inspired Bathroom Retreat
Incorporating natural materials like wood, limestone, and slate in bathroom designs is trending in 2025. This approach replaces traditional materials like marble, creating a warm, natural spa aesthetic. Using the same finish across ceilings, walls, and vanities results in a cohesive, calm, and luxurious environment that feels both rich and down-to-earth. (architecturaldigest.com)
